GENTEXT/REMARKS/1.  The Fiscal Year 2024 (FY24) Transition Conversion (TC) Board will convene on or about 13 June 2023.  Aviators who can demonstrate that transitioning platforms within Marine Aviation is in the best interest for the Marine Corps are encouraged to apply.
2.  Available programs:
2.a.  The following programs are available for active duty Marine officers (read in four columns):
MOS      PROGRAM           APPLICANT-PMOS        NOTE
7318     MQ-9 Pilot        7525,32,63,65,66,88   1
7532     MV-22 Pilot       7563,65,66            1
7556     KC-130 Pilot      7532,63,65,66         1
7598     RW to Strike      7532,63,65            1
75XX     NFO to SNA        7525,88               2
75XX     NFO to PFIP       7525,88               3
75XX     T-6 to T-45       7532,63,65,57         4
2.b.  Notes
2.b.1.  Applicants selected for any TC PMOS will incur an Active Duty Service Obligation (ADSO) which will run concurrently with any pre-existing obligations.  ADSO are for the following:
Note 1:  4 years from training completion
Note 2:  8 years from training completion
Note 3:  6 years from training completion
Note 4:  3 years from training completion
3.  Eligibility requirements
3.a.  All applicants:
3.a.1.  Pilots and Naval Flight Officers (NFOs) with less than 13 years commissioned service (YCS) as of 13 June 2023 are eligible to apply.  Favorable general officer (GO) endorsements for applicants with greater than 13 YCS may be considered.
3.a.2.  Applicants must have 18 months time-on-station (TOS) by 1 June 2023.  TOS exceptions from MMOA, such as for applicants on one-year PCS orders, should be documented prior to the board.
3.a.3.  Applicants must be able to execute orders in FY24.  Training completion is also expected in FY24 apart from 7598 and 7599 trainees.  Inability to meet these timeline requirements may result in forfeiture of FY24 selection and the fleeting up of an alternate.  PCS and training dates will be coordinated by MMOA once the board results have been released.
3.a.4.  Applicants must not have been selected on a previous TC Board.  Contact your monitor for exceptions to policy.
3.b.  Certain applicants may be eligible for multiple programs and are encouraged to select and rank programs according to interest.
3.c.  NFOs applying for the 75XX or 7318 transition must obtain a 4 or higher for the Academic Qualification Rating (AQR) and a 6 or higher for the Pilot Flight Aptitude Rating (PFAR) on the Aviation Standard Test Battery (ASTB).
3.d.  NFOs interested in applying for the 75XX Primary Flight Instructor Program (PFIP) may contact their monitor for further details.
3.e.  The 7598 (RW to Strike) applicants who are selected can expect orders to receive a T-6 warm-up syllabus prior to attending jet training.
3.f.  Those previously eligible for the Aviation Bonus (AVB) will retain eligibility under their current PMOS until being awarded a new PMOS.  Subsequent eligibility for AVB under a new PMOS can be coordinated with MMOA if applicable.
3.g.  Applicants who require past ASTB scores or need to take the ASTB may contact Naval Aerospace Medical Institute (NAMI) by sending an email to:  usn.pensacola.navmedoptractrpns.list.nmotc-astb@mail.mil with the request.
3.h.  T-6 to T-45 applicants should have a minimum of 800 hours as a T-6 Instructor Pilot, hold standardization and flight leadership qualifications, and include a letter of recommendation from their VT CO with their application.
4.  Coordinating instruction.
4.a.  TC applications must be submitted via the NAVMC 10274 Administrative Action (AA) request form.  Refer to the MMOA-3 Manpower Website at https:(slash)(slash)www.manpower.usmc.mil/webcenter/portal/OA3RR/pages_home.  This AA form must be submitted with signed command endorsements.
4.b.   Command endorsements must include the first O-6 level commander in the applicant’s current chain of command and address the applicant's potential for success in the desired program.
4.b.1.  Endorsements shall also address the command assessment on the applicant executing a PCS in FY24, career timing implications, and the applicant’s PME status.
4.c.  All applications must include the following as enclosures to the AA form:
4.c.1.  A copy of a signed and current medical upchit (DD2992) that indicates the eligibility for the programs listed in the application.
4.c.2.  The results of the applicant's most recent ASTB.
4.c.3.  Correspondence from their PMOS monitor stating that the officer meets TOS requirements (as indicated in paragraph 3.a.2), is not in receipt of orders, career timing supports, and is eligible to apply.
4.c.4.  In addition to endorsement from the applicant's current chain of command, TC applicants currently assigned to non-flying billets (e.g., Forward Air Controller, staff, resident school, etc.) must include a letter of recommendation from the commanding officer from their last flying assignment.
4.d.  Additional letters of recommendation are not required but are highly encouraged.  Letters of recommendation should address the aviation abilities or potential of the applicant.  Any letters of recommendation should also be included as enclosures to the AA form.
5.  Application submission:
5.a.  All applications must be submitted as a single .PDF file to only the MMOA-3 Organizational Mail Box at SMBMANPOWEROFFICERPR@USMC.MIL and labeled as "EDIPI_LastName_TC".
5.a.1.  The deadline for TC applications is 2359 Eastern Standard Time 1 June 2023.  Applications received after this deadline will not be considered.
5.a.2.  Direct questions regarding the application process to the points of contact listed from MMOA-3.  Direct aviation-specific questions to the point of contact listed from MMOA-2.
